I earned my Doctorate as a Psychiatric Mental Health Nurse Practitioner from the University of Utah and treat mental health conditions across the lifespan. I have a passion for OCD and anxiety disorders and completed an internship in exposure and response prevention (ERP) in addition to the Behavior Therapy Training Institute (BTTI) through the International OCD Foundation. I believe in a collaborative and personalized approach utilizing ERP, DBT, medication management, integrative treatments, and Ketamine Assisted Psychotherapy (KAP).
My approach to wellness utilizes evidence-based practices, holistic care, behavioral modifications, integrative treatments and medication management. I do not believe in a "one size fits all" treatment approach and strive for a partnership with each client toward an individualized plan to improve well-being and function.
